Hello, I have 12 duck eggs in the incubator.
Temps are misleading, incubator thermometer says 100.3, the little one I added to the inside is telling me 92. Humidity is ok at 48%. I can't why to the store for another day or so to get a new thermometer, this only going on 24 hours of them being in the incubator. Do you think the eggs will ok? If the 100.3 is accurate is that to hot? If the 92 is accurate is that to cold? Hand rotating 4-5 times a day.

Was the little one you put in calibrated ?
If not don’t go by it
I have a few I bought off amazon that do that same thing
I would go off machine until you get a calibrated thermometer in there
Put the temp to 98.6-98.8 for now
The machine won’t be off by to much
Higher heat is worse then cooler for developing

I incubate ducks at 100. So I'd say I'd be more worried if the one that says 92 is right.
Get a fish tank thermometer when you can and do an ice bath yeast by putting equal amounts of ice and water in a cup and submerging the thermometer for a minute or so. It should read 32 degrees. It does not then you can just make a mental note of how far off it is.. and adjust your incubator temp accordingly.
 
Also I like to keep my humidity around 30 to 35% until lockdown. 45 should not hurt.. but I wouldn't add any more water and let it get any higher.
